The striking vehicles of “Artimobile” made a stop-over in the central courtyard of the Council headquarters yesterday.
The aim was to show college students of 13 - 15 years old the various career opportunities open to them - with its sights set clearly on the future and confident of the personal and professional success of youngsters who aspire to excellence.
The cute and clever cars were fully kitted out with interactive software and packed with information about the careers available.
It’s part of a national operation which has been taken on the road by professional organisations and the Chambers of Commerce and Trades which is raising awareness in youngsters about 250 different careers.
They also had the opportunity to talk with tradespeople and training professionals. Part of the programme of “Professional Discovery”, it has been put in place with the collaboration of the Ministry of Education.
From 13th to 15th March: Regional andDepartment Contest for the Best Apprentice, Halle au Blé, Alençon. Nearly 100 young adults will be presenting their work and undergoing assessments.
